The college library has an excellent collection of books, journals, magazines and technical publications by both Indian and Foreign authors that are not only relevant to the courses offered but are also of academic interest. The Central Library has a newly constructed modern building with a seating capacity for 200 readers and separate seating. arrangements are provided for staff members and Post-graduate students. There are about 56,600 books in the general library section and a lot many for book bank section. All the latest journals, magazines are made available to the students for various branches. A good collectionof books on General Knowledge and Competitive Exams is also present.

Course Name CIVIL Electrical Mechanical Electronics & Telecom. Computers Total
No. of  Books 11712 11493 11250 10029 12080 56564
No. of Technical Journals (National & International) 17 15 14 16 18 80
The library is looked after by a member of the staff who acts as the Officer-in-Charge and also has a Librarian for administrative purposes. 

Annual Library Expenditure: 
Total investment on Books & Journals during the last two years:
        a) Books (Rs.) : 3.5 Lakhs
        b) Journals (Rs.) : 0.5 Lakhs

Total Investment on Books & Journals as on date:
        a) Books (Rs.): 47 Lakhs
        b) Journals (Rs.): 3 Lakhs

Students of each year are allowed to borrow books from the library on a particular day of the week and retain the book for a period of two weeks. Renewal of the book provides an extension of one week. A library card is issued every year to all students.

The library is open during college working hours throughout  the semester and is open for use by students during the Preparatory Leave (PL) for longer hours. 

 Regular Hours: 10:45 a.m. - 5:30 p.m. 
 PL Hours:         8:00 a.m.-10:00 p.m.

Book Bank

The book bank is an extension of the library. Every semester, students of all  classes can take 3-4 books each from the book bank at a discounted value of 10% of the book's cost and retain the books till the end of the semester. This facility helps curtailing the students expenditure on books. The book bank is well stocked with numerous copies of each book required by the students.

Students are issued books based on their positional merit in their class. Positional merit is dictated by the previous examination appeared for. Books are issued to students at the beginning of each semester.
Both, the Library and the Book Bank are under an Officer     -in-Charge who is a staff member. A Librarian and Assisstant Librarian look after the day to day functioning of the library and book bank.
